Origins and Family
Gian Luca Perici was born in Bassano del Grappa[2]. He was born on +1964-09-17T00:00:00Z[3].
Career and Affiliations
Recorded occupations include Catholic priest[4], nuncio[5], and Catholic deacon[6]. Positions held include titular archbishop[9], a Roman Catholic episcopal title[28]; Apostolic Nuncio to Zambia[10]; and Apostolic Nuncio to Malawi[11].
